Mother's Day at Embrey Mill

Mother. Momma. Mommy. Mom.

She’s the one always by your side, the one who’s helped you grow and learn, and the one we celebrate every second Sunday in May on Mother’s Day.

Did you know that the idea of Mother’s Day started forming right after the Civil War? It’s true. What began as a movement to reunite families that had been divided by the war, eventually evolved into the holiday we now know when it was made official in 1914.

Family Pinch Pot Tea Cups Workshop

On Saturday, May 11, at 10am, Corgi Clay Art Center is having a 1.5-hour Family Pinch Pot Tea Cups Workshop. In this class, you’ll be instructed in how to use the pinch pot method to build your very own teacups. This class is good for ages 6 and up, so every generation can make something meaningful for the previous one.

For younger kids, this is the traditional way to make mom a hand-made object d’art she’ll treasure forever. And for adults with adult parents, this is your time to take that classic gift to the next level! Tuition includes clay, communal tools, and two firings. Downtown Fredericksburg Flower Crawl

On Saturday, May 11, take Mom to Downtown Fredericksburg and have a day of shopping and strolling—and flowers! Enjoy a leisurely lunch and then start the Downtown Fredericksburg Flower Crawl, which runs from 3:00–6:00pm.

Buy your ticket online and then check-in at the Visitor Center by 5:30pm. You’ll get a list of participating shops, which you can then explore with Mom. At each stop, you’ll get a flower. And once you’ve finished the crawl, you’ll have a whole bouquet (and any other presents you’ve purchased along the way).
